Operations security (OPSEC) is a discipline of military origins that in the computer age has become vital for government and private organizations alike. OPSEC is a process by which organizations assess and protect public data about themselves that could, if properly analyzed and grouped with other data by a clever adversary, reveal a bigger picture that ought to stay hidden. The term was first coined in the U.S. military during the Vietnam War, as a result of an effort led by a team dubbed Purple Dragon.”]
